    drip feeding yasnac mx2 (mori mv40)

    I am wanting to drip feed my yasnac mx2 controller. I already send programs via the rs232 cable into the memory. Now I want to drip feed so that I don't have to break my programs up. I have done as much research as I can and still can not get it to work. I am using Editcnc as my dnc software. I am hoping to get mastercam sometime soon and try that to drip feed. What do I need to do on the control when I am trying to drip feed? I have tried multiple things but nothing has worked yet. I need to know the proper procedure!!     I believe if you set 6003.0 to 1 and 6003.1 to 0, you shoud be able drip feed in TAPE mode.

    Drip Feed (DNC) is not available on this control. You have to install a Behind Tape Reader (BTR) to emulate the Tape Reader being fed a Tape via a PC. In this case the cable from the external device is connected directly to the BTR. When a BTR is installed, TAPE mode at the control is used.
